Callaway reported Q2 2026 results and raised full-year 2026 Adjusted EBITDA guidance to $246M-$260M alongside a revised net sales outlook of $2.045B-$2.070B.

Counterpoint
Margin gains include a non-recurring tariff refund benefit on a GAAP basis, so investors may discount durability of gross margin expansion.
